Real-World Testing: Putting Hoppes 24017VD BoreSnake Viper Den Bore Cleaner Rope 338/340 Cal to the Test
First Use Experience
My first experience with the Hoppes 24017VD BoreSnake Viper Den Bore Cleaner Rope 338/340 Cal was at my local shooting range after a morning of zeroing my .338 Lapua. The rifle had seen about 40 rounds, leaving a noticeable amount of copper fouling in the bore. I decided this would be the perfect opportunity to put the BoreSnake to the test.
The conditions were dry and relatively warm, around 70 degrees Fahrenheit, with a light breeze. The ease of use was immediately apparent. I simply unscrewed the cap of the Viper Den, attached the pull handle, dropped the weighted end down the bore, and pulled it through. The process was remarkably smooth, requiring a firm but steady pull.
After the first pass, I examined the BoreSnake itself. It was noticeably dirtier, indicating that it had indeed removed carbon and copper fouling. I was surprised at how much debris it had collected in a single pass. There were no immediate issues or surprises, apart from the sheer speed and convenience of the cleaning process.

Breaking Down the Features of Hoppes 24017VD BoreSnake Viper Den Bore Cleaner Rope 338/340 Cal
Specifications
- Caliber: Designed specifically for .338 and .340 caliber rifles. This ensures a snug fit within the bore, maximizing cleaning efficiency.
- Integrated Bronze Brush: A crucial feature for scrubbing stubborn carbon and copper fouling from the bore. The bronze brush is positioned strategically to loosen debris before the rope section removes it.
- Cleaning Rope: The rope section is designed with a large surface area – reportedly 160 times larger than a standard patch. This increased surface area allows for effective removal of loose debris and solvent residue.
- Viper Den Storage Case: A durable plastic case with a built-in handle. This case not only protects the BoreSnake during transport but also serves as a convenient pull handle.
- Compact Design: The BoreSnake and Viper Den are designed to be easily portable. This is especially useful for shooters who travel to different ranges or hunting locations.
